A curated list of 18 podcasts exploring clean energy, conservation, agriculture, and the land-use tradeoffs at the heart of the climate transition. Describe what you're in the mood for, or narrow the list with filters.

Factor This!
by Paul Gerke
A weekly clean energy podcast from Renewable Energy World covering solar, storage, and grid trends, including a multi-part series on agrivoltaics with land-use and policy experts. Hosted by content director Paul Gerke for listeners tracking the energy transition professionally.

Growing Impact
by Penn State Institute of Energy and the Environment
A monthly Penn State podcast profiling seed-grant-funded faculty research, including episodes on solar energy's land-use tradeoffs with agriculture. Covers a broad range of energy and environmental science beyond land use specifically.

Energy Policy Now
by Andy Stone
The Kleinman Center for Energy Policy's weekly podcast, hosted by journalist Andy Stone, examines energy policy debates including an episode on the land-use tensions of rapid renewable buildout. Produced for listeners with some energy-policy background.

Resources Radio
by Resources for the Future
A weekly podcast from Resources for the Future featuring economists and researchers discussing environmental and resource policy, including renewable energy siting and habitat tradeoffs. Aimed at an audience with some familiarity with environmental economics.

Mountain & Prairie
by Ed Roberson
Long-form interviews with conservationists, ranchers, and land managers of the American West, hosted by Ed Roberson, with recurring coverage of Great Plains grassland loss and restoration. The show blends land conservation, ranching culture, and outdoor storytelling.

Catalyst with Shayle Kann
by Shayle Kann
A weekly climatetech podcast hosted by investor Shayle Kann, featuring an episode identifying land access as an underdiscussed bottleneck for decarbonization technologies. Aimed at professionals already fluent in climate technology and markets.

Volts
by David Roberts
David Roberts's independent podcast dissects clean-energy policy and technology in technical detail, including recurring discussion of the land requirements and siting conflicts of wind and solar buildout. Built for listeners comfortable with wonky energy-policy detail.

Investing in Regenerative Agriculture and Food
by Koen van Seijen
Koen van Seijen's long-running interview series features farmers, investors, and scientists working to scale regenerative agriculture and land stewardship globally. Aimed at practitioners and investors rather than general audiences.

Climate Rising
by Mike Toffel
A Harvard Business School podcast hosted by professor Mike Toffel, examining how companies and investors are responding to climate change, including an episode on scaling regenerative agriculture through carbon markets. Uses a case-study, business-school format.

My Climate Journey
by Jason Jacobs & Cody Simms
A widely followed climate solutions podcast where hosts interview founders, scientists, and policymakers about decarbonization, occasionally covering land-use and clean-energy siting debates. Framed for newcomers to climate work who want an accessible entry point.

Nature Breaking
by World Wildlife Fund
World Wildlife Fund's general-audience podcast explains the science and stakes behind major conservation issues, including an episode on why America is losing its grasslands. Designed to make conservation topics approachable for non-specialists.

Ear to the Ground
by Land Stewardship Project
Land Stewardship Project's long-running podcast features Midwest farmers, ranchers, and land managers discussing regenerative grazing, land access, and its benefits for grassland bird habitat. Aimed at working farmers and rural land stewards.

The Prairie Farm Podcast
by Nicolas Lirio & Kent Boucher
A conservation and homesteading podcast covering prairie restoration, native plants, and small-scale agriculture, hosted by Nicolas Lirio and Kent Boucher. Casual and accessible, aimed at hobbyists and land stewards rather than researchers.

Ranch Stewards Podcast
by Ranchers Stewardship Alliance
Produced by the Ranchers Stewardship Alliance and hosted by Haylie Shipp, this podcast profiles ranchers and conservationists working to protect Northern Great Plains grasslands. Aimed at a general audience interested in rangeland stewardship.

Banking on Solar
by Bart Frischknecht
Host Bart Frischknecht interviews project financiers and developers about what makes solar projects bankable, including agrivoltaic and dual-use solar financing. Aimed at renewable energy finance professionals.

Grounded
by Oregon Department of Energy
The Oregon Department of Energy's podcast, hosted by Bryan Hockaday, covers state energy topics for a general audience, including an episode on agrivoltaics and dual-use solar farming. Explains energy concepts without assuming prior expertise.

Everyday Environment Podcast
by Illinois Extension
A University of Illinois Extension podcast exploring environmental science topics for general audiences, including an episode on agrivoltaics and solar-agriculture integration. Hosted by Illinois Extension educators Abigail Garofalo, Erin Garrett, and Amy Lefringhouse.

Watt's Up, Wisconsin?
by Wisconsin Energy Institute
The Wisconsin Energy Institute's podcast covers state energy research and policy, including an episode on agrivoltaics possibilities for Wisconsin farms. Aimed at listeners with some interest in regional energy policy.
